在软件开发的世界里,敏捷开发方法已经成为主流。但是,组建一个完整的敏捷团队需要产品经理、架构师、开发人员、测试人员、UX 设计师等各种角色,对于个人开发者或小团队来说,这几乎是不可能的任务。
直到 BMAD-METHOD 的出现,这一切都改变了。
BMAD-METHOD( Breakthrough Method of Agile AI-Driven Development )是一个突破性的 AI 代理编排框架,它的核心理念是通过专门的 AI 代理来模拟完整的敏捷开发团队,让一个人就能拥有整个团队的力量。
专业角色完整覆盖
真正的敏捷工作流 不是简单的 AI 助手,而是严格遵循敏捷方法论的完整流程,每个 AI 代理都有明确的职责和交付物。
在开始使用 BMAD-METHOD 之前,首先需要在你的项目中安装框架:
npx bmad-method install
这个命令会在你的项目中安装 BMAD-METHOD 框架,自动配置所有必要的 AI 代理和模板文件。安装完成后,你就可以开始使用各种角色命令了。
🧠 使用 /analyst
命令启动分析师角色
/analyst
📋 使用 /pm
命令呼唤产品经理角色
/pm
🏗️ 使用 /architect
命令呼唤架构师角色
/architect
📝 使用 /sm
命令呼唤 Scrum Master 角色
/sm
💻 使用 /dev
命令呼唤开发者角色
/dev
🔄 重复步骤 4-5 ,直到项目完成
/sm → 创建下一个故事
↓
/dev → 实现故事
↓
/sm → 创建下一个故事
↓
/dev → 实现故事
↓
... 持续循环
通过简单的斜杠命令,你可以在 Claude Code 中无缝切换不同的专业角色:
让我们看一个真实的 BMAD-METHOD 应用案例:polyv-live-cli
这是一个完全使用 BMAD-METHOD 开发的 CLI 工具项目,用于管理 Polyv 直播云服务:
项目特点:
BMAD-METHOD 应用成果:
开发效果:
这个项目完美展示了一个人如何通过 BMAD-METHOD 拥有完整团队的协作能力,从需求分析到最终交付的全流程管理。
在这个 AI 时代,不再是机器取代人类,而是人类与 AI 协作,创造更大的价值。BMAD-METHOD 让每个开发者都能拥有一个完整的专业团队,让创意不再受限于资源,让想法真正变成现实。
"一个人的力量 × AI 的智慧 = 无限的可能"
想了解更多 BMAD-METHOD 的实战技巧和最佳实践?请关注我们的后续文章,我们将深入分享更多实用的开发经验和案例分析。
![]() |
1
putaozhenhaochi 17 天前 via Android
有点意思
|
![]() |
2
terryso OP @putaozhenhaochi 如果不知道想做什么产品, 可以呼唤出分析师 Mary, 她会引导你和她对话, 和你一起做头脑风暴, 最后给你生成一份项目简报, 挺有用的.
|
![]() |
3
zhangleijuly 17 天前
之前用过 3.0 版本的,对话生成方案的地方挺不错的,能聊出来很多没想到的问题,生成的内容也比较详细。就是 Epic 和 Story 这套结构不太符合国内的习惯,最后没有使用。
|
![]() |
4
terryso OP @zhangleijuly 我们开发使用 scrum 流程, 这套就比较符合我们
|
5
riceball 17 天前
正好作为角色可以参考。Thanks.
|
![]() |
7
sunbigfly 2 天前 via Android
牛逼的,试了一下
|